> When using a cluster of switches, some topologies will have an MDIO
> bus per switch, not one for the whole cluster. Allow this to be
> represented in the device tree, by adding an optional mii-bus property
> at the switch level. The old platform_device method of instantiation
> supports this already, so only the device tree binding needs extending
> with an additional optional phandle.
